Anne Louise Germaine de Staël Quote

If we would succeed in works of the imagination, we must offer a mild morality in the midst of rigid manners; but where the manners are corrupt, we must consistently hold up to view an austere morality.


The Influence of Literature upon Society (1800), Pt. 2, ch. 5
